This is a US Model 1936 pistol belt used during World War II. The Khaki web belt measures 42" when fully let out, accommodating up to a 40" waist. There weren't to many fat Infantrymen back then! This one was manufactured before mid 1942, as the keepers are brass instead of steel. The belt is free of stains, shows honest wear and all the eyelets are present. Some of them do have some verdigris, but that can cleaned up easily enough. It has a very distinct US stamp to the left of the ammo pouch snap. The maker mark is stamped on the inside of the belt just above the snap, but I can not make it out. This is a nice example of a Model 1936 pistol belt that saw service though the Korean War.
